编程思维是一种解决问题的逻辑方法,它不仅限于编写代码,更强调如何高效地分析和处理信息。在编解码设计中,编程思维能够帮助开发者快速找到最优解决方案,减少冗余操作。
编解码技术广泛应用于数据传输、压缩和加密等领域,其核心目标是确保数据的准确性和效率。通过编程思维,可以将复杂问题拆解为可管理的模块,从而提高设计的灵活性和可维护性。
在实际操作中,开发者需要明确输入与输出的格式,以及转换过程中的关键步骤。这要求对数据结构和算法有深入理解,才能实现高效的编解码逻辑。

AI绘图结果,仅供参考
例如,在设计一个自定义编码方案时,可以通过观察数据特征,选择合适的编码方式,如哈夫曼编码或Base64,以平衡速度与压缩率。这种决策过程正是编程思维的体现。
实践中,测试和优化同样重要。通过不断验证和调整,可以发现潜在问题并提升性能。编程思维鼓励持续改进,使编解码系统更加稳健和高效。
总结来说,编程思维为编解码设计提供了清晰的思路和实用的工具,帮助开发者在复杂场景中实现高质量的解决方案。